I'm in my junior year of high school now and have decided to direct my future towards having a career in art. Whoopie, i've chosen a great path apparently and people tell me, ' oh you're so good your gonna make millions of dollars and blah blah blah' (and they've only seen my anime art lol. they don't know that it's gonna get me nowhere in life). Before you freak out, anime isn't the only thing i draw, i've got plenty of realism i've been working on for a while Wink

I find two subjects that interest me and draws my attention the most and i would love to possibly major in Illustration and Sequential Art since i love making posters, T-shirts, and making comics. But even if i took those courses and graduated, will it get me somewhere as a career? would i really be able to make enough money?

what kind of jobs out there could i consider getting in those fields? i'd love to hear your feedback

Animators seem to get paid pretty horribly. You're not going to get rich out of realism either.


From what I understand, what pays money is stuff like graphic design and advertising.
